Union County High School is a secondary school located in the North Georgia Mountains in Blairsville, Georgia, United States. It is recognized for making an impact in the community and ranking No. 1 in the school district.

The school's mascot is the black panther. Its rivals are Fannin County High School and Towns County High School. The band is called the Pride of the Mountains.
